The move-connectivity conjecture for rotationally symmetric plabic graphs
The move-connectivity conjecture for rotationally symmetric plabic graphs
Let and be minimal rotationally symmetric plabic graphs, and let and denote their associated permutations.
Move-connectivity conjecture. If
then and are related through a sequence of rotationally symmetric moves.
Each rotationally symmetric move preserves the associated permutation, so the conjecture asks whether all minimal rotationally symmetric representatives of a given permutation lie in one move-equivalence class. This is presented as an expected extension of the preceding lemma and is not proved in the supplied text.
